Employee Records and Documentation
  • Maintain and update digital employee records, including job titles, status changes, compensation details, and contact information.
  • File and track compliance documents such as I-9s, W-4s, NDAs, and policy acknowledgment forms.
  • Assist in onboarding and offboarding workflows by preparing and tracking welcome packets, checklists, and documentation status.
Payroll Support and Data Prep
  • Compile hours worked, PTO usage, and deduction data for payroll submission based on time-tracking systems or manager inputs.
  • Reconcile basic discrepancies between timesheets and policy rules (e.g., holidays, leave eligibility) and flag exceptions to HR/Payroll leads.
  • Ensure payroll inputs are complete and submitted on time to internal payroll processors or external providers.
Leave and Time-Off Tracking
  • Log and update sick leave, vacation time, FMLA, and other leave types into tracking systems or spreadsheets.
  • Notify managers or HR leads of upcoming leave events and ensure supporting documentation is received and filed.
